EchoKrunch is a rough mix Animusic posted on SoundCloud. It is the third song on the Sound of 12 album released. Not much is known about the visual of this piece, but you can look at some of the instruments shown on Animusic Kickstarter images you can see some that may be featured in this song.


At 2:36 into the piece a riff can be heard that sounds very similar to "Prophets of War" by Dream Theater.